Effects of Background Noise on the Speech Acoustics of People With Aphasia

Dixon, Kirsten 06 August 2021 (has links)
This study investigated the effect of hearing six background noise conditions (silent baseline, pink noise, monologue, lively conversation, one-sided phone call, and cocktail noise) on acoustic measures of speech production during story retells in people with aphasia. Eleven individuals with aphasia and 11 age- and gender-matched control participants took part in the study. Participants heard the background noise conditions through open-back headphones while they retold six short stories. The examiner calculated mean and standard deviation of intensity, mean and standard deviation of fundamental frequency (F0), and speech rate in words per minute. A Matlab application that identified pauses (i.e., periods of silence greater than 200 ms) computed a speaking time ratio measure (i.e., time speaking versus time pausing). With the exception of the monologue and one-sided phone call condition, both people with aphasia and control participants significantly increase their intensity and F0 in the presence of background noise. Additionally, participants with aphasia have significantly lower speaking time ratios and speaking rates when compared to control participants. Participants make acoustic changes while hearing background noise; speech intensity rises in an effort to increase the signal-to-noise ratio, while mean F0 increases due to a presumed rise in subglottal pressure. Further research is suggested to investigate other acoustic differences, possibly at the segmental level, between speech produced in informational and energetic background noise.

The effect of phonological and semantic cues on word retrieval in adults

Burrill, Katheryn Elizabeth 01 January 2008 (has links)
Word retrieval difficulties can affect individuals who have had strokes or head trauma (Goodglass & Wingfield, 1997) and to a lesser extent, typically aging adults. This can affect an individual's ability to name pictures accurately and quickly. Cues are used to help individuals with word retrieval difficulties in fmding specific words. Two commonly used cues are semantic and phonological cues. Semantic cues can be information about the word the person is trying to retrieve, such as its definition, and/or its functions. Phonological cues are usually the initial sound of a word that a person is attempting to retrieve. Previous research has suggested that both of these cues, in isolation, are effective in stimulating word retrieval during naming tasks (Li & Williams 1989; Stirnley & Noll 1991 ). However, research has not investigated the effects of combining these two cues during picture naming tasks. The current study observed participants under four different cueing conditions during a picture naming task with the Boston Naming Test. The four conditions include a control group (received no cues), a semantically cued group (received a semantic cue before being asked to name a picture), a phonologically cued group (received a phonological cue before being asked to name a picture), and a semanticallyphonologically cued group (received a semantic and phonological cue before being asked to name a picture). Each group was compared on number of items correctly named and response times. The results indicated that there was no statistically significant difference between the groups with regard to number of items named. There was a statistically significant difference found between the groups with regards to response times. These findings are discussed and compared to previous research and current word retrieval theories.

Social participation in working-age adults with aphasia : an updated systematic review

Pike, Caitlin January 2017 (has links)
Background: A previous systematic review found limited data regarding social participation in working-age people with aphasia (PWA). This population has many roles to fulfill, that are negatively affected by aphasia. A review of recent studies may reveal more information on the challenges in re-establishing social roles and thus may inform treatment thereof. Method: The aim was to provide an updated systematic review on social participation in PWA under 65 years of age. Studies from 2005-2017 were searched from Scopus, Pubmed and Psychinfo. Search terms were derived from the International Classification of Functioning, Disability and Health (ICF) and the Aphasia- Framework for Outcomes Measures (A-FROM). Aspects of domestic life, interpersonal relations and interactions, education and employment and community, civic and social life were investigated. Results: From 2,864 initial hits, 11 studies were identified, all of which were on the American Speech-Language-Hearing Association (ASHA) Level III of evidence. The studies indicated that participation in domestic life is reduced and PWA showed reduced social networks, loss of friendships and changes in the quality of marital relations. Few PWA returned to work or spent time on education. Limitations in community, civic and social life were noted and there were contradictory findings on the impact of contextual factors on social participation. There was an increase in research into contextual factors impacting on social participation in PWA and in the use of conceptual frameworks in the last decade. Conclusions: Social participation in working-age adults is limited across the social domains. While the ICF conceptual framework is increasingly used, no studies used the A-FROM. Upplevelser av kommunikation hos patienter med afasi till följd av stroke : en litteraturstudie / Experiences of communication in patients with aphasia due To stroke : a literature review

Hultman, Fabiola, Elakrami, Nezha January 2020 (has links)
Background: Aphasia is a language disorder that usually occurs after a brain injury. It is common for the disease to occur in connection with stroke. In Sweden, approximately 8,000 - 10,000 people suffer from aphasia each year, thirty-five percent of them are middle-aged and active. Patients with aphasia have difficulty communicating, which affects several different aspects of the individual's daily life. Aim: The purpose of this literature review was to describe experiences of communication in daily life in patients with aphasia due to stroke. Method: The literature review was performed according to Friberg's model, based on qualitative scientific articles collected from the databases PubMed and Cinahl Complete during the period 2005–2020. Results: The results from twelvescientific articles were used to describe experiences of communication in the daily life of patients with aphasia. This was divided into three main themes: Disease suffering, life suffering and care suffering. The first theme was divided into four different subthemes, the second theme was divided into two subthemes and the third theme had no subthemes. The result was experiences of losing friends, roles in communities and in the family. Changed world of life, led to despair and anger. Many experienced sadness and loneliness. Close relatives and their partners played a significant role in making them feel well. Conclusion: The literature study has shown the importance of communication in the patient's everyday life and conveyed the greatest responsibility that both healthcare staff and society have for treating patients with aphasia, which contributes to a better quality of life.

Correlations Between Cognitive Pause Patterns and Listener Perceptions of Communicative Effectiveness and Likeability for People With Aphasia

McConaghie, Heidi Raylene 16 June 2021 (has links)
A prevalent feature of typical spontaneous speech are speech pauses. Longer speech pauses, known as cognitive pauses, occur in typical speech and are indicative of higher-level cognitive processes. Atypical cognitive pauses, however, are prevalent in the speech of people with aphasia consequent to their communication disorder. Research has shown that these atypical pauses may contribute to negative listener perceptions. This study aimed to determine the influence of atypical speech pause on listener perceptions of communicative effectiveness and speaker likeability. Specifically, this study evaluated the relationship between listener ratings of communicative effectiveness and likeability and acoustic measures of between-utterance pause duration, within-utterance pause duration, and the location of within-utterance pauses. This study also examined the relationship between listener ratings of communicative effectiveness and likeability. Target stimuli included 30-second samples of speech from two individuals with mild aphasia and four with moderate aphasia. Using a visual analog scale, 40 adult listeners listened to these speech samples and rated each sample according to the speaker's communicative effectiveness and likeability. Overall, listeners were not as sensitive to between-utterance pauses. While listeners were more sensitive to within-utterance pauses greater than one second, they were similarly impacted by within-utterance pauses between 250-999 milliseconds. Listeners were also more affected by pauses at the beginning of an utterance than at the end of an utterance. Results also demonstrated a strong positive correlation between listener ratings of communicative effectiveness and likeability. In general, results suggest that the location and length of pauses in the speech of people with aphasia have an impact on listeners' perceptions. In combination with future research, the results of this study will provide a deeper understanding of the impact of cognitive pause in people with aphasia, thus improving future clinical assessment and treatment of aphasia.

Speech Pause in People With Aphasia Across Word Length, Frequency, and Syntactic Category

Mitchell, Lana 14 June 2022 (has links)
This study is an examination of how a word’s syntactic category, word length, and usage frequency might impact a speaker’s use of communicative pause. Previously collected between and within utterance language samples from 21 people with aphasia (Harmon, 2018) were evaluated in this study. Participants consisted of 11 individuals diagnosed with mild or very mild aphasia and 10 individuals with moderate aphasia;15 who exhibited fluent subtypes and 6 non-fluent subtypes of aphasia. Data from the Corpus of Contemporary American English (COCA) was used to code the word frequency and syntactic category of each word in the language samples. Generally, speakers with both non-fluent and fluent aphasia produced more monosyllabic words of very high frequency with a greater percentage of function words than content words. Analyses revealed no significant correlations between the pause duration for either the word length or word frequency for either group of speakers. In relation to syntactic category, no significant differences in pause duration were found between content and function words in the between utterance condition. However, non-fluent speakers preceded content words with significantly shorter pause durations within utterances when compared with the function words. Due to differences in sample sizes between the speaker and syntactic groups, non-parametric statistics were used for some comparisons. In addition, this study does not fully account for the influence of fillers and incomplete words. Despite these limitations, this study will contribute to the research regarding communicative speech pause in speakers with aphasia and provide insight into more useful diagnostic and treatment strategies.

Effect of Positive and Negative Emotion on Naming Accuracy in Adults with Aphasia

Nielsen, Courtney Paige 12 June 2020 (has links)
This is a preliminary study investigating the effects of emotion on a confrontational naming task in people with aphasia (PWA). Previous research investigating the effects of emotion on various language tasks in PWA has produced mixed findings with some suggesting a facilitative effect and others an inhibitory effect. Participants included 9 adults with aphasia as the result of a stroke, resulting in the presence of word-finding deficits (i.e., anomia). Participants named images in positive, negative, and neutral conditions. Responses were scored as either correct or incorrect; incorrect responses were coded further to illustrate individual error patterns. The majority of participants demonstrated a decrease in naming accuracy in the negative condition compared to the preceding and subsequent neutral conditions. The results of this study suggest that negative emotional arousal may cause PWA to devote attentional resources to emotional regulation and away from the linguistic task, thus interfering with language performance. Further research is needed to support these preliminary findings.

Effects of Positive and Negative Emotional Valence on Response TimeDuring a Confrontational Naming Task: Findings from People with Aphasia and Young Adults

Loveridge, Corinne Jones 17 June 2020 (has links)
The purpose of the current study was to determine the effect of emotional arousal and valence on linguistic processing of adults with aphasia and neurotypical young adults. Nine people with aphasia (at least 6 months left hemisphere stroke and presenting with word retrieval deficits) and 20 young adults (reporting no evidence of neurological injury) participated. All participants completed a confrontational naming task during three conditions that were manipulated according to emotional arousal and valence: positive (high arousal, positive valence), negative (high arousal, negative valence), and neutral (low arousal, neutral valence). Average response time was measured for pictures named accurately within each condition. In general, participants with aphasia named pictures more slowly than young adult participants. Neither participant group had significant differences in response time across conditions. Individual participants varied in how emotional valence affected their response times. Further research is needed to identify what factors lead to differing responses to the high-arousal conditions.

Physiological Arousal, Emotion, and Word Retrieval in Aphasia: Effects and Relationships

Johnson, Angela Lynne 16 June 2021 (has links)
People with aphasia are known to have poor word retrieval abilities in communicative tasks. It has also been reported that they have lower, non-optimal levels of physiological arousal, which may cause lower attention levels therefore contributing to poor performance on linguistic tasks. The purpose of this study was to investigate the relationship between physiological arousal and word retrieval in adults with aphasia and neurotypical adults when presented with emotional stimuli within a confrontational naming task. Participants included 6 people with aphasia and 15 neurotypical controls. All participants completed a confrontational naming task within 3 emotional conditions (neutral, positive, negative) and physiological measures (Heart Rate Variability, Skin Conductance) were taken simultaneously. No statistically significant results were found; however, numerical trends were identified in the data that may provide direction when designing future studies.

The Perceived Effect of Pause Length and Location on Speaker Likability and Communicative Effectiveness

Price, Julia M. 30 July 2021 (has links)
Previous studies have examined the effect of atypical speech pause on conversational fluency and how the conversational listener perceives the speaker. The present study investigated the effect of pause duration of increasing length and in differing sentential locations on listener perceptions of communicative effectiveness and speaker likability. One neurotypical male and one neurotypical female speaker recorded three sentences from the Quick Aphasia Battery, and artificial pauses of varying lengths (250 ms, 400 ms, 550 ms, 700 ms, 850 ms, and 1 sec) were inserted before the subject, verb, and object of each sentence. The six baseline (unmodified) sentences were also included among the stimuli. These samples were randomly interspersed among foil samples that consisted of 30-second recordings of six people with fluent and nonfluent aphasia of mild to moderate severity. Forty adult participants (24 females and 16 males) listened to and rated the modified and foil samples for communicative effectiveness and the perception of likability of the speaker. A review of the data revealed that pause location may negatively impact speaker likability depending on the gender of the speaker. However, due to the small sample size of speakers (one male and one female) and factors that were not controlled for in this study (e.g., speaker pitch, speech rate, resonance, articulation patterns), these results require validation through further research that utilizes a larger sample. As pause duration increased, both speaker likability and communicative effectiveness ratings decreased. These findings suggest that monitoring pause duration and location in preliminary fluency samples could be beneficial to assess fluency severity and determine appropriate treatment goals. Wordfinding treatment may want to focus on vocabulary words that serve the function of subjects and objects in sentences. Although there are limitations in the methodology and results of this preliminary study, it is hoped that this study combined with future research can help to inform assessment and treatment of people with aphasia and other neurophysiological disorders that lead to atypical pause.
